    A solution to WGA (KB892130) failure to install

    I, like a lot of people with genuine copies of windows, have experienced
    problems with installing KB892130. I've been in and out of a lot of posts on
    the subject and tried various offered solutions which have (and have not)
    worked for some people. After numerous variations, the following has worked
    and I'm now able to run the update service as it was intended.

    Download psexec.exe from:-

    http://www.sysinternals.com/Utilities/PsExec.html

    and put the file in root directory (C:\)

    Download the WGA update executable from:-

    http://www.download.windowsupdate.co...82dcea49a0.exe

    and install in C:\temp.

    Rename the file in C:\temp to WGA.exe (original file toooooo long)

    At DOS command line type:-

    psexec -i -s c:\temp\WGA.exe

    The above tested and works - for me at least - Hope it works for others

    Thanks so much. I worked on this problem since last night and your fix
    works. Of course, some people have to bit a little tech savvy to
    understand the dos commands, but it works. My only suggestion is that
    when you get to a dos prompt, type c:\ to get to the root where
    psexec.exe is located. Also, only choose the psexec.exe file when you
    unzip the program because it has many many files. The others are not
    needed.
